SB 175 Kentucky Senate · 2026 Regular Session

AN ACT relating to the establishment of the Kentucky Health Command.

Summary
Create a new section of KRS 42.720 to 42.742 to define terms; establish the Kentucky Health Command in the Commonwealth Office of Technology; require the Kentucky Health Command to contract with a private sector entity to develop and provide standards and qualifications for the utilization of an artificial intelligence-assited virtual health platform; establish a process by which rural health care providers and facilities may contract for use of the aritificial intelligence-assisted virtual health platform; establish a process for distribution of net advertising revenue; establish activities the virtual health platform may perform; prohibit the virtual health platform from engaging in the practice of medicine or diagnosing or treating any disease, illness, or medical condition; amend KRS 42.724 to conform.
